  • "Checking your addons for compatibility with this version of Firefox" hangs

    On one pc (but not others) running Windows 7, when I install a new version of FF and the box for "checking your addons etc" comes up, it gets 80% of the way through then just grinds away until I hit cancel. Is there any way to find outr which addon is causing this problem?

    It is possible that there is a problem with the file(s) that store the extensions registry.
    Delete the files extensions.* (e.g. extensions.sqlite, extensions.ini, extensions.cache) and compatibility.ini in the Firefox profile folder to reset the extensions registry.
    *https://support.mozilla.org/kb/Profiles
    New files will be created when required.
    See "Corrupt extension files":
    *http://kb.mozillazine.org/Unable_to_install_themes_or_extensions
    *https://support.mozilla.org/kb/Unable+to+install+add-ons
    If you see disabled, not compatible, extensions in "Tools > Add-ons > Extensions" then click the Tools button at the left side of the Search Bar (or click the "Find Updates" button in older Firefox versions) to check if there is a compatibility update available.
    If this hasn't helped then also try to delete the addons.sqlite file.

  • Best color workflow with hdv source material?

    Hi,
    I am wondering about the best workflow for working with hdv material in color?
    My first Color experience, I sent a AIC timeline (hdv source) to color, made my corrections, clicked NO when sending back to fcp when asked if I wanted the rendered timeline to be conformed to color render settings (apple pro-res) as I wanted the same sequence settings back in fcp.
    I then tried to off/online back to my source hdv capture files, and therein arose the problems. Because color had renamed the files, the new names came up in the re-connect media window, not the hdv source. When ignoring these and locating the hdv source, the corrections were not attached.
    After advice, tried onlining the original, locked edit, opening in color - files came up red (offline?), but could not apply the grades from the previous project anyway, as the whole program crashed before I could do anything?
    Thoughts on workflow, theories on what I may have done wrong greatly appreciated.
    Lastly, a lot of noise appeared in some clips I adjusted in color, which did not occur when making similar corrections to the same clips using the 3-way color corrector within fcp itself.
    How come?
    Thanks for listening,
    -Tom

    Hi Tom, agree 100% with all of JP OWENS comments on this thread. This is very good advice.
    Myself, coming from the dark side of a SONY HDV (HVR-Z1P) and DUMPING the SONY for a Panasonic DVCPROHD HVX-200 iFRAME HD format 66mbs and 110Mbs DVCPROHD 4:2:2 CODEC was primarily because when using COLOR on the HDV it was as dreadful as JP OWENS says it is.
    As as has been mentioned in this thread, for working with HDV and trying to perform any reasonable grading using color.app you would indeed move it all to  PRORES422 by either:
    • ingesting it as proposed from the source as APPLE PRORES 422 or
    • ingesting and then BATCH CONVERTING in FCP (or go via a COMPRESSOR.app DROPLET - a favourite of mine) and THEN importing that into FCP.
    It gives you these workflow advantages (again pointed out by Mr Owens):
    • iFRAME format editing in FCP is "faster" (not GoPs to play with in 25Mbs MPEG2 HDV)) and
    • workflow transcoding is faster. (many threads in these forums concerning exporting from an HDV timeline).
    However to roughly quote Stu Maschwitz (his DV REBEL book) "+..converting DV to a near loss-less codec is a bit like carrying a golf ball around in a streamer trunk+".. applying this to HDV as well simply meaning that there is also NOT much colour information to work with in grading.correction applications like color.app.
    Thus there is NO colour benefit from working in prores 422 from HDV source.
    IN short, work in PRORES422 from your HDV source and your workflow will improve and efficiencies will be seen.

  • Best "Capture" workflow for projects mixing HDV tape and XDCAM footage

    I'm trying to determine the best workflow for projects that combine XDCAM and HDV footage.
    I'd obviously do the editing in a project designed for XDCAM, as that's the higher quality footage,
    and render the HDV clips in the XDCAM timeline...ending up with an XDCAM end product.
    I'd use SONY'S XDCAM TRANSFER to get the clips into FCP.
    My question concerns capturing the HDV footage in this scenario. I've never been able to get
    the Log and Capture feature for HDV footage to work, unless I've created an HDV project and am capturing into that HDV project.
    So, generally, I create an HDV project, open the log and capture utility which is now set to capture HDV, and then capture the footage. I then close that project and create a new project, designed for XDCAM footage. I use XDCAM Transfer to get the XDCAM footage into the project, and I import
    the previously captured HDV footage into that browser and start editing, rendering the HDV in the XDCAM timeline.
    My question...do I really have to open, what is essentially a "fake" HDV project just to capture that HDV footage? You don't seem to have the option of capturing HDV footage (out of a camera or HDV tape deck) directly into an XDCAM project. If I try to change the capture or audio video settings of the XDCAM project to HDV, you get messages saying you can't do it.
    Is there something I'm missing or a more streamlined way of doing this?
    Thanks in advance for any input.

    No need to jump through these hoops. Just set yourself up with a universal Easy Setup that will handle both. Choose your regular XDCAM HD Easy Setup then open the Audio / Video Settings window and change the Capture Preset to "HDV" and the Device Control Preset to "HDV Firewire" ... then click the "Create Easy Setup" button and save it for recall whenever needed.
    Regarding the overall workflow, I'd seriously question the idea of creating XDCAM HD masters. No real benefit to that unless you need to export to XDCAM HD. Much better would be export your final master as Apple ProRes 422.

  • Need Help with HDV Capturing

    if i want to capture HD with final cut pro
    do i need a specific hard drive or it'll work on 7200rpm
    and do i need a specific card for not loosing quality if i wanna work full HDV or firewire is ok
    Can anyone help me please
    Thank You

    You're asking about HDV, which is an MPEG2 compressed format. It has about the same bandwidth as DV NTSC. Its 1080i version is about 3.6 MB/sec.
    That measn it will run fime on a single 7200rpm hard drive. AS with any media files, you should install a second SATA drive inside your G5 for all your media files.
    Now if you want to do full uncompressed 1080i HD, that runs at ,say, 140 MB/sec, and you do need a special capture card for that, like a Kona card from Aja or a DecklinkHD card from Blackmagic Design, and a very fast external drive array as well.

  • HELP NEEDED CAPTURE DV FOOTAGE WITH HDV VIDEO CAMERA

    I'm trying to capture DV video footage I've done years ago with my Sony DCR-HC40E PAl into FCP version 6. with my new camera HDV video Sony HDR-HC7 1080.i/mini dv so I can capture it into FCP but it's jerky, An yone know the setting for both the HDv camera and FCP to get the footage perfect as the rginal video.
    Cheers

    From the FCP menu bar: Final Cut Pro > Easy Setup > DV-PAL > OK. (Use DV PAL Anamorphic if you shot wide screen).
    Menu bar once more: Sequence > Settings > Set Sequence Preset > OK.
    That camera should detect the DV format tape and playback with the correct settings automatically.
    All you ned to do is connect it via FireWire and capture.
